Muslim Council of Elders' Communiqué on
The Zionist Colonial Entity's Violations against Al-Aqsa Mosque, and the Attempts to Impose Temporal and Spatial Division of the Noble Sanctuary of Al-Aqsa
Thursday- Dhu al-Hijjah 23, 1436 A.H./October 8, 2015 A.D.
In the Name of Allah; may Allah's Peace and Blessings be upon His Messenger, his Household and his Followers.
With serious concern, the Muslim Council of Elders have been following recent developments in Jerusalem and Al-Aqsa Mosque, regarding the blatant violations and desecrations at the hands of the Zionist colonial entity in the compound and prayer halls of Al-aqsa Mosque, especially the entity soldiers’ brutal practices since August 23, 2015. These practices clearly violate human values and religious principles, and even contradict the International Law and all international resolutions. In addition, these practices are a flagrant violation against religious freedom ensured by the United Nations Universal Declaration of Human Rights (1948), Resolution 217.
The Muslim Council of Elders considers these practices and criminal operations as part of the Judaization project planned long time ago and which became clear through the procedures of dispossession of the largest possible areas of land from Palestinians to create a new geopolitical reality of Jerusalem. This came to be clear as well through the establishment of Jewish settlements, driving native population away from their lands to impose a new demographic reality and to cause a demographic imbalance in East and West Jerusalem, where Jews would be the majority of the population, under the protection of the occupying army.
In this regard, the Muslim Council of Elders condemns the repeated violations against Al-Aqsa Mosque "the Noble Sanctuary" (the First Qiblah and the third-holiest site in Islam) as these violations have increased recently with the extremist Jewish organizations storming Al-Aqsa Mosque under the protection of the Army of the Zionist colonial entity. The Zionist army helps these organizations through allowing them to violate prayer halls of the Mosque, block the passageways leading to the Mosque, desecrate its holy symbols, prevent Muslims for long times from entering the Mosque and enjoying their historical and Divine right in this Mosque, which is a solely Muslim place of worship and can never be shared or distributed under any circumstances.
The Muslim Council of Elders as well strongly condemns excavations going on in full swing under and around al-Aqsa Mosque, under the pretext of the alleged Temple.
The Muslim Council of Elders calls on the Muslim nation, the international community and the UN to prevent Judaization of Jerusalem and effacing its Islamic and Christian landmarks and to stop forced displacement of native Muslim and Christian population of Jerusalem.
The Council calls on all Muslims to pay careful attention to the issue of Jerusalem to protect Al-Aqsa Mosque and to stop the Zionist barbaric and planned violations aiming at the destruction of Al-Aqsa Mosque or the destruction of its prayer halls and compound.
The Muslim Council of Elders calls on the International community to prevent the Zionist colonial entity from such unethical practices and to assert the necessity of abiding by the international law and the international resolutions in this regard.
